- The South Georgia College Entry Program is a university entry program located on the campus of Valdosta State University. It allows students to complete all developmental studies and college preparatory curriculum deficiencies, plus core college courses, in order to enter the university as a sophomore.

- Valdosta State University in collaboration with South Georgia College responded to the teacher shortage in Georgia by initiating a Special Education/Early Childhood Education dual degree program in 2005. This program provides a unique opportunity for future teachers who are pursuing or have an Associates Degree, an Early Childhood Degree or a degree in any field. These future teachers may earn a Bachelor's and Master's degrees in Special Education and Early Childhood Education (Pre- kindergarten through grade 5) by attending classes offered by Valdosta State University at South Georgia College.
